which part in the steering column allows for changes in the angle between the upper and lower shafts?
The part in the steering column that allows for changes in the angle between the upper and lower shafts is the universal joint.
The universal joint, also known as a U-joint or Cardan joint, is a mechanical device that enables changes in the angle between two shafts that are not in a straight line. In the context of a steering column, the upper and lower shafts are connected by a universal joint.
As the steering wheel is turned, it exerts rotational force on the upper shaft of the steering column. The universal joint allows for the transmission of this rotational motion while accommodating changes in the angle between the upper and lower shafts. It provides flexibility and compensates for any misalignment between the two shafts, ensuring smooth and continuous rotation of the steering column.
The universal joint typically consists of two yokes connected by a cross-shaped component with needle bearings. These bearings allow for rotation in multiple axes, allowing the steering column to handle variations in the angle between the upper and lower shafts during steering movements.

The discriminant of the quadratic formula is the name given to the portion underneath the radical (or the square root)"
\(x = \frac{1}{2} (-b\frac{ + }{ - } \sqrt{ {b}^{2} - 4ac })\)
Discriminant = D = b²-4ac
If D is less than 0 you have two complex solutions.
If D is equal to 0 you'll have one real solution.
If D is bigger than 0 you'll get two real solutions.
So here we have:
a=1
b=8
c=12
Which means D=64-4(1)(12)=64-48=16>0
D is bigger than 0, so you'll have two real solutions. And since 16 is a perfect square, they'll both be rational numbers.

Terran’s running rate is 4 miles per hour faster than her walking rate. She can run 21 miles in the same amount of time it takes her to walk 9 miles. What are her walking and running rates in miles per hour? Write and solve a rational equation to answer the question. Let x be Terran’s walking rate.
Answer: She walks at 3 miles per hour, and runs at 7 miles per hour.
Step-by-step explanation:
Let's define:
R = running rate
W = walking rate
We know that:
R = W + 4mi/h
and:
"She can run 21 miles in the same amount of time it takes her to walk 9 miles."
Here we can remember the relation:
Distance = time*speed
The above sentence says that, for a given time T, we have:
21mi = T*R
9mi = T*W
Then we have a system of 3 equations:
R = W + 4mi/h
21mi = T*R
9mi = T*W
To solve this, we could start by isolating T in one of the equations, let's do it in the last one:
9mi/W = T
Now we can replace that in the second one to get
21mi = 9mi*(R/W)
In this equation we could isolate R to get:
R = (21mi/9mi)*W = (7/3)*W
Now we can replace that in the first equation:
R = W + 4mi/h
(7/3)*W = W + 4 mi/h
And now we can solve this for W.
(7/3)*W - W = 4mi/h
(4/3)*W = 4mi/h
W = (3/4)*4mi/h = 3mi/h
And we could use also the first equation to find the running rate:
R = W + 4mi/h = 3mi/h + 4mi/h = 7mi/h
Then:
She walks at 3 miles per hour, and runs at 7 miles per hour.
